About This Role

This role involves dispensing clinic supplies, materials, and instruments for dental patient care and preclinical activities, as well as managing inventory.

Responsibilities

  • Dispense clinic supplies, materials, and instruments for all patient care activity and preclinical activity
  • Prepare various packages and kits for distribution and ensure tracking of assets
  • Ensure proper utilization and compliance with clinic equipment loan policies and procedures
  • Take inventory of instruments and maintain inventory level and records
  • Identify and replace instruments as needed

About Indiana University

The Indiana University (IU) School of Dentistry has been advancing oral health in the state and beyond since 1879, over the past 140 years, becoming a national leader in preparing oral health professionals, conducting innovative research, and providing patient-centered care.
